Instead of going through the trouble of removing parts to get it off, if you jack the vehicle at the point where the front arm bolts to the chassis, it will raise the engine away from the axle giving you more clearance to pull the undertray out, you may have to give it a few yanks but its bound to be covered in oil etc so will slide out without having to remove any other parts !!!
